  • Each year, we offer scholarships to pupils demonstrating outstanding ability in their chosen field. Successful pupils are rewarded with an annual amount deducted from their fees which lasts throughout their time at the school.

    Langley Prep Scholarships are for entry into Years 3-8 at the Taverham site. These are reviewed at the point of entry to the Senior School. Prep School Scholarships are available in the following areas: Academic, Creative Design, Drama, Music and Sport.

    Langley Senior Scholarships are offered at 11+ (Year 7), 13+ (Year 9) and 16+ (Year 12) entry points at the Loddon sites. Senior School Scholarships are available in the following areas: Academic, Art, Computing, Drama, Design and Technology, Food and Nutrition, Languages, Music, Photography and Sport.

    A Langley scholarship offers fee remissions at 15% of the annual fee alongside enrichment and educational opportunities designed to maximise potential in our Scholars.

    The scholarship programme runs alongside the means-tested bursary programme. Those receiving a scholarship will be able to apply for a bursary if they need assistance in paying school fees. Scholarships are based on interviews, performance and assessment.

  • Langley Sixth Form is proud to offer the Anthony Arthur Coward Scholarship, a prestigious opportunity for students with exceptional academic potential and demonstrable socio-economic need to gain a fully-funded place for two years of Sixth Form. This scholarship honours the legacy of Anthony Arthur Coward, a former Langley student from London who boarded at the school during the 1960s and 70s. His positive experience at Langley inspired his aunt, Barbara Hunt, to establish this scholarship in her will—creating a lasting tribute to the care and education he received.

  • For families who would not be able to afford the full Langley fees, we offer financial assistance ranging typically up to 50% of fees.

    Eligibility is assessed via means testing. Any family wishing to make an application for fee assistance should apply through the broader admissions process. A confidential ‘statement of financial position’ will be required from families of children invited to attend an interview.
